TIPLA sponsors two Symposiums a year for patent attorneys, patent agents, trademark attorneys, and copyright attorneys. Each symposium includes lectures by Tennessee attorneys and others who speak on topics of interest to those who practice patent, trademark, copyright, and IP law in general. In the past, distinguished judges have appeared, as have officials from the Patent and Trademark Office.

Fall 2001 Symposium

The Fall 2001 Symposium was held on November 16 and 17 at the Doubletree Inn in Nashville.
